Understanding Ductless AC Systems

Ductless AC systems, often referred to as mini-split systems, consist of two primary parts: an outdoor unit and one or more indoor units, all connected by a thin conduit housing refrigerant lines and power cables. This unique setup allows for targeted, zoned cooling without the massive energy losses associated with traditional ductwork, making them especially beneficial for:

  • Older homes built without existing duct systems.
  • Home additions or converted garages where extending ductwork is impractical.
  • Apartments or condos with limited space.

Key Components and Operation

The system operates based on these core components:

  • Outdoor Unit: Contains the compressor and condenser. This is where the heat is released from your home.
  • Indoor Unit (The Evaporator): Typically mounted on walls or ceilings, this unit delivers cooled, filtered air into the room and can be adjusted independently via its own remote or thermostat, establishing a "zone."
  • Refrigerant Line: A small bundle of lines and wires that runs through a tiny hole (about three inches in diameter) in the wall, connecting the indoor and outdoor components.

One of the standout features of ductless systems is their ability to operate efficiently across different zones. Each indoor unit functions independently, giving you the power to cool only the rooms in use. This capability increases comfort while simultaneously reducing your monthly utility expenses.

Ductless AC: Superior Efficiency and Quiet Comfort

Ductless AC systems offer notable, research-backed advantages over traditional central air systems, particularly regarding energy loss and noise pollution.

1. Enhanced Energy Efficiency

Traditional duct systems are prone to leaks. Energy Star estimates that typical duct systems lose 20% to 30% of conditioned air due to leaks, holes, and poor insulation. Ductless systems, by eliminating the ductwork, eliminate this energy waste entirely. Furthermore:

  • Zoning: You aren't cooling an empty attic or a guest room when nobody is using it. This individualized cooling approach dramatically cuts energy use.
  • Inverter Technology: Many modern ductless units use variable-speed compressors (inverter technology), allowing the unit to run continuously at a lower speed instead of constantly cycling on and off. This precision control uses significantly less energy than traditional, single-stage compressors.

2. Quieter Operation

The most noticeable component of a traditional AC system (the air handler) is often installed in a closet or attic near living spaces, leading to noise intrusion. In ductless systems, the noisier components (compressor and condenser) are located outside, while the indoor units are designed to run whisper-quietly, often producing less than 20 decibels of sound—less than a hushed conversation.

Installation and Maintenance for Poseyville Homes

Proper installation and maintenance of ductless AC systems are crucial to ensure they operate efficiently and at peak performance for years to come.

The Streamlined Installation Process

The installation process is far less invasive than that of central air:

  1. Placement: Trained professionals select the optimal location for both the indoor and outdoor units to maximize performance, airflow, and minimal aesthetic impact.
  2. Mounting and Drilling: The indoor unit is mounted, and a small conduit hole is drilled to accommodate the connecting lines.
  3. Connection: The refrigerant, condensate, and power lines are run, creating a closed, efficient loop.

This streamlined installation is perfect for Poseyville homeowners looking to add AC without the significant construction and disruption involved with running new ductwork.

Essential Routine Maintenance

Regular maintenance is critical for efficiency and air quality. This includes:

  • Filter Cleaning: The indoor unit's filters must be cleaned routinely (often monthly by the homeowner) to maintain good air quality and maximize efficiency.
  • Professional Tune-Ups: Our technicians recommend scheduling periodic inspections to clean coils, check refrigerant levels, and ensure the condensate line is clear. This preventative care identifies issues early, preventing costly repairs down the road.
